Subject: Handover — Queuewarden autoscaler

Hi Tomas,

As discussed, I'm handing over the Queuewarden queue-depth autoscaler before my leave. It polls broker depth every 15 seconds and scales the worker fleet between 2 and 40 replicas. Thresholds live in the scaler_config table; don't edit them directly in production without updating the change log. Alerts route to the support rotation. If scaling stalls, check the poller pod first, then the metrics store. For troubleshooting queries, connect using the connection string below.

Thanks,
Priya

replica DSN, fadup-yagug: mssql://rusox_svc:0K2wrVJefbkR2n@db-53b3.qirvangrid.example:5432/istix

Subject: Large-deal discount policy — effective immediately

Team,

Deals above 250k now require CFO sign-off for any discount over 12%. Standard tiers stay unchanged. Finance will reject quotes that skip the approval chain in Vexora's pricing tool. Margin erosion on the Calthrop account forced this. No exceptions through quarter-end. Questions go to Priya in revenue ops. The rationale ties directly to the plan summarized below.

board note of baweg-bawig: Project Tamath slips by six weeks because of the audit delay.

## Spokeway rebalancer — runbook

Spokeway computes overnight van routes to rebalance bikes across Dockfield stations. If routes look absurd (empty vans crossing town), the demand forecast feed is stale; the solver itself rarely misbehaves. Kill the run, refresh the feed, rerun. Do not hand-edit route output. Before approving any change, verify the solver config matches production, shown below.

deployment values, kajep-kageg:
[praix]
host = praix.paliqcorp.corp
user = praix_svc
database = praix_prod

## Deploying the Gatewick Proctor Queue

Deploys are pretty painless: push to main, wait for the pipeline, then watch the queue drain dashboard for five minutes. If candidates pile up mid-exam, roll back first and ask questions later — the queue replays safely. Everything the workers care about lives in one config block, shown here for reference.

settings of bafof-yagef:
JOROX_PIN=8740
JOROX_TENANT=pelox
JOROX_METRICS_HOST=metrics.jorox.qorvelworks.internal
JOROX_SEAL=seal_c78f63c1
JOROX_STANDBY_TEAM=norax